    <title>2025 (3) TMI 1169 - KERALA HIGH COURT</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=767783</link>
    <description>The Court held that the Tribunal erred in dismissing the appeal as not maintainable, emphasizing that an open remand under Section 263 of the Income Tax Act allows for fresh consideration of the merits without necessitating a separate challenge. The Court set aside the Tribunal&#039;s order, restoring the appeal for fresh consideration and directing the Tribunal to dispose of the appeal in accordance with the law. This decision favored the assessee, allowing the appeal against the revenue to proceed on its merits.</description>
